The high mileage definition is a moveable one with these cars. Anything over 50K on say a 4200 now then you may well say that its getting into high mileage territory but in 4 or 5 years time then you will be hard pushed to find anything under that mark.
What was the perceived area of a high mileage 3200 5 years ago ? A high percentage of the 3200's that appear for sale now are in the 60K to 90K mile region.
It's nice to have a low mileage car but these cars are between 8 and 14 years old now for the 4200 so unless we have changed the cats then we have as much chance of the cats breaking up and destroying the engine on a low mileage car as we do on a higher mileage car.
